It's dependant on what sort of truck you're having it fitted to and whether any cutting process is involved and whether you have the ability to fit it yourself or take it to a third party to have it fitted. Sliders in the glass also has an effect on the price naturally. Mine's in tomorrow for fitting.

Glass costs are listed here:
